Ulefone Armor 20WT

The Ulefone Armor 20WT is a rugged smartphone that boasts a plethora of features and top-of-the-line specs. The device comes with a detachable antenna and walkie-talkie functionalities, making it an ideal choice for outdoor enthusiasts and professionals. One of the standout features of the Armor 20WT is its durable design. The phone's IP68 rating ensures that it can withstand water and dust ingress, while its shock-resistant construction provides added protection against accidental drops. The phone also comes with a range of accessories, including a dedicated armor case, clip, Carabiner, multi-mount, tools, antenna, charging brick, and more. The multi-mount is particularly impressive, allowing users to mount the phone on various surfaces, making it easy to capture hands-free footage or use the device as a walkie-talkie. In terms of performance, the Armor 20WT packs a punch. It features a fast Helio G99 processor, 12GB of RAM (expandable up to 20GB), and a large battery that provides all-day power. The phone also has a high-quality camera system, which captures impressive photos and video. One of the most innovative features of the Armor 20WT is its walkie-talkie functionality. With a range of up to 10 kilometers, users can enjoy real-time communication with multiple parties simultaneously, without the need for Wi-Fi. This feature makes the phone an excellent choice for outdoor enthusiasts, professionals, and emergency responders. Overall, the Ulefone Armor 20WT is a formidable device that offers an impressive combination of durability, performance, and features. Its price point is also competitive, making it an attractive option for those in the market for a rugged smartphone with a walkie-talkie twist.

Ulefone Note 17 Pro

The Ulefone Note 17 Pro is a budget-friendly smartphone that offers impressive features at an affordable price point. The device boasts a stunningly smooth 120Hz display, making it ideal for gaming and multimedia use. Its premium-looking design and generous storage of 256GB are also notable highlights. Under the hood, the Helio G99 processor and 12GB of RAM provide efficient performance for everyday tasks, such as browsing, social media scrolling, or casual gaming without overheating. While not record-breakers, these specs deliver reliable performance in real-world scenarios. However, the camera system is a letdown, with decent photos from the main 108MP sensor but shaky videos due to the lack of image stabilization. The mono speaker also falls short, requiring earbuds for immersive audio experiences. In terms of gaming, the Ulefone Note 17 Pro handles popular titles like Asphalt 9: Legends and Call of Duty Mobile with ease, averaging around 90fps in the latter. Battery life is respectable, lasting four days on average use, and charges quickly to 100% with its 33 watts fast charger. Ultimately, this phone is suitable for those prioritizing style, decent performance, and value over high-end features like top-tier gaming or advanced camera capabilities. Its price point of under $300 makes it a compelling choice for users seeking everyday functionality wrapped in a good-looking package.
